Beta vulgaris subsp. vulgaris 'Boltardy'

What a useful and nutritious vegetable. Excellent for salads or steam and serve alone or with a white sauce (will turn pink) as an alternative vegetable. You can also use the mature leaves just like Spinach or Chard. As the name suggests, bolt- resistant. The deep red flesh has a smooth skin. Roots will store all Winter without loss of flavour if plunged in course sand or well composted bark.

How To Grow Beetroot 'Boltardy'

Sow mid April to late July.
Sow 2 seeds 4" apart in rows 12" apart. Sow in 1" deep drills. When the seedlings are 1" high thin out to one plant per station or allow to grow to table tennis ball size to eat as baby beat leaving one to grow larger. You can do this with Swedes and Turnips too.
We have also sown these, as we have carrots, in cells and transplanted very successfully
